Homes in Escrow in the Stateline, NV area of the South Lake Tahoe Real Estate Market.
We have just updated the Stateline, NV Real Estate Market Escrow Report. At present there are 17 homes in escrow. That same number was 17 two months ago. (see chart below)
Note that we’ve also added stats below for the number of homes in escrow that are distressed sales (foreclosures and/or short sales).
While it does appear that the market is still in decline in terms of value, it is important to note that 70% of homes currently in escrow are distressed sales (REOs or short sales).

Escrow Summary:
Here’s what the latest escrow information tells us about current market conditions in Stateline, NV:
- The Median Price for the homes in escrow is $460,000 (not including Lake Front Properties and homes in Glenbrook).
- It was $559,000 two months ago. (See study about "conformity" and foreclosures here.)
- Escrow normally takes about 60 days.
- The homes in escrow now generally reflect buying activity from March forward.
Escrow and Inventory:
The chart tracks the number of listed homes and those in escrow since November of 2006.
- There are 126 available listings in Stateline, NV right now.
- There are 20 homes in escrow.
- This is 8 more homes in escrow than at the end of October last year.
Escrow and Foreclosures:
Of the 20 homes currently in escrow in Stateline, NV:
- 14 are distressed sales (70%)
- 12 are short sales
- 4 are bank owned properties (REOs)
